Bill Clinton used a little cultural appropriation to make a dig at Republicans on Tuesday.
Just hours before his wife took a drubbing in the Wisconsin primary election, Clinton ridiculed the tone of Republican debates.
“I like our primary a lot better than theirs,” Clinton told an audience in Elmont, New York.
“We never had a spectacle like they did — remember that debate they had before Florida where three of them were up there calling each other liar over everybody else’s voice?
“It sounded like a rap tune on MTV.”
Clinton then mimicked what they must have thought a “rap tune” must be like on MTV.
“You’re a liar. I’m a liar,” he said in chant-like fashion.
